boston to provincetown...anyone got a good route?

anyone got a link to a cue sheet with a good sized map that follows the route? I'm doing the MS ride down to Provincetown..but im going the 175 over two days. i'm looking for something i could try doing in one day (so quickest, shortest route possible)

Not in Eastham, there aren't any shoulders. But Route 6A is and is very scenic. Route 6 north of Wellfleet is better but I'd still stick to the back roads as much as possible

The cape portion of this route looks pretty good.

For the off-cape portion, I would suggest you use the cue sheets for the 75 mile MS route, it might be a tad longer but it's a lot nicer than riding with all the traffic on routes 18 and 58
